Summary

The Billing Administrator is directly responsible for performing data entry and related duties in the calculation, preparation, and issuance of bills, invoices, and account statements. This includes maintaining ledgers, credit balances, and resolving account irregularities. This position involves diplomatic interaction with customers to provide billing information and support in order to facilitate swift payment of invoices due to the organization. The Billing Administrator also provides the billing and administrative support to Project Managers.
